Setting up a business in the UAE, especially in Dubai, is one of the most attractive prospects for entrepreneurs and investors globally. With a strategic location, business-friendly policies, and access to regional and international markets, Dubai offers unmatched opportunities. In this comprehensive guide, we’ll walk you through every stage of the business setup in Dubai process, covering everything from initial planning to licensing and beyond.
Why Choose Dubai for Business Setup?
Dubai is a global business hub offering several advantages:
- 100% foreign ownership in many sectors (especially in UAE free zones)
- World-class infrastructure
- A tax-friendly environment
- Access to a diverse and affluent customer base
- Streamlined company formation in Dubai procedures
These factors have made Dubai a top choice for those wanting to start a business in Dubai efficiently and affordably.
Step 1: Define Your Business Activity
Before initiating the process, it is crucial to define the nature of your business. Whether you’re entering the tech startup UAE scene, offering consulting services, or establishing a retail outlet, the activity determines the type of license you’ll need.
Step 2: Choose the Right Jurisdiction
You’ll need to decide whether your business will operate in:
- Mainland – allows you to trade anywhere in the UAE
- Free Zone – offers benefits like full foreign ownership, tax exemptions, and easier free zone business setup
- Offshore – suitable for international business without a physical UAE presence
Pro Tip: Each jurisdiction has different regulations and benefits. It’s important to compare them carefully. For a detailed comparison, check our upcoming blog on “Top Free Zones in UAE for Tech Startups“.
Types of Business Licenses in the UAE
Understanding the type of license you need is essential, as it governs what activities you’re legally allowed to conduct. The main license types include:
- Commercial License: For trading and general commercial activities like import/export, retail, wholesale, etc.
- Professional License: For service providers, consultants, artisans, and professionals such as IT specialists, legal advisors, or designers.
- Industrial License: Required for companies involved in manufacturing or industrial activities.
- Tourism License: For businesses in the travel, tourism, and hospitality sectors.
- Freelance Permit: Issued in certain free zones to individuals offering services under their own name without setting up a full company.
Each license type has specific documentation, fees, and activity lists that must be aligned with your intended business.
Mainland vs Free Zone vs Offshore — Comparison Table
Feature | Mainland Business | Free Zone Business | Offshore Business |
Ownership | Up to 100% (depending on sector) | 100% foreign ownership | 100% foreign ownership |
Market Access | Anywhere in UAE + globally | Inside free zone + globally | International only (not UAE) |
Office Requirement | Mandatory physical office | Flexi-desk or virtual offices often allowed | No office required |
Regulatory Body | DED (Department of Economic Development) | Free Zone Authority | Offshore Authority (e.g., JAFZA) |
Tax Benefits | Subject to UAE corporate tax | Tax incentives in many free zones | No taxes on income from abroad |
Banking Access | Full access to local banks | Full access, but more scrutiny | Limited (depends on bank policies) |
Visa Eligibility | Eligible | Eligible (based on office space) | Not eligible |
Business Activity Scope | Wide range, including government contracts | Limited to zone-approved activities | Holding or consulting activities |
Step 3: Select a Legal Structure
Your legal structure affects your liability, tax obligations, and documentation. Popular structures include:
- Limited Liability Company (LLC)
- Sole Establishment
- Branch of a Foreign Company
- Civil Company
Choosing the right one ensures compliance with UAE business laws and future scalability.
Step 4: Register the Trade Name
Choosing a business name that aligns with UAE regulations is essential. It should:
- Reflect the business activity
- Avoid religious or political terms
- Be unique and available in the UAE trade name registry
Step 5: Apply for Initial Approval
Once your trade name is approved, you’ll need to get initial approval from the relevant authority. This step signifies that the UAE government has no objection to you starting your business.
This is also the phase where you’ll begin preparing key documents, such as:
- Shareholder passports
- Proposed lease agreement
- Business plan (depending on activity)
Step 6: Office Space and Location
Depending on your jurisdiction, you’ll need to lease office space:
- Mainland: Physical office is mandatory
- Free Zone: Options for flexi-desks, coworking spaces, or offices
Your office location may impact license costs and visa eligibility.
Related read: “Business Setup in Sharjah Free Zone“
Step 7: Finalize License and Registration
Once all documents are approved and submitted, you’ll be issued a trade license. This is your legal permission to start business operations in Dubai.
Step 8: Open a Corporate Bank Account
This step is often underestimated. UAE banks have strict compliance standards, and many require in-person visits, especially for non-residents.
Freezoner offers full corporate banking assistance in UAE, helping you:
- Choose the right bank
- Prepare and translate documents
- Schedule meetings with bank representatives
Learn more in our detailed blog on “Benefits of Setting Up a Business in UAE Free Zones” and “How to Open a Corporate Bank Account in UAE” (coming soon).
Step 9: Visa Processing
As a business owner, you can apply for your investor visa, and depending on your license, sponsor employees and family.
Visa quotas vary depending on your office size, business type, and jurisdiction.
Step 10: Start Operations
Once your company is licensed and your bank account is active, you’re ready to launch! From marketing to operations, now is the time to build your presence and grow.
Final Thoughts
Setting up a business in Dubai is a structured yet rewarding process. With expert guidance and an understanding of the legal landscape, you can navigate your journey smoothly. Freezoner offers expert support for every stage—from company formation in UAE to corporate bank account setup.
Need help getting started? Contact us today for a free consultation and explore tailored packages for your business goals.